Autopsy Report: Multiple Blows and Chokehold Caused Liliana Resinovich's Death
The autopsy of Liliana Resinovich revealed four impact points on her face and right hand, consistent with an assault, and a 'chokehold' causing a perimortal fracture to the T2 vertebra, leading to her death.
- How does the distribution of injuries support the conclusion of an assault?
- The report details injuries to the left forehead, right temple, right lip, and right hand, described as 'poly-district' impact. This pattern strongly suggests an assault, not an accident.
- What evidence definitively rules out accidental death in the Liliana Resinovich case?
- The autopsy report on Liliana Resinovich revealed four distinct impact points on her face and right hand, ruling out accidental death. These injuries indicate multiple blows, inconsistent with a simple fall.
- What specific mechanism of death is indicated by the perimortal fracture and the described 'chokehold'?
- The cause of death was determined to be a 'chokehold,' a maneuver causing a perimortal fracture of the T2 vertebra. This suggests a struggle and intentional asphyxiation.
